Jonathan Dunn v. Lloyd Austin, III, et al

Case Summary

On 02/28/2022 Jonathan Dunn filed a Civil Right - Other Civil Right lawsuit against Lloyd Austin, III,. This case was filed in U.S. Courts Of Appeals, U.S. Court Of Appeals, Ninth Circuit. The case status is Pending - Other Pending.

#32

(#32) Filed order (A. WALLACE TASHIMA, MICHELLE T. FRIEDLAND and BRIDGET S. BADE) Order by Judges TASHIMA and FRIEDLAND; Dissent by Judge BADE. Appellants opposed emergency motion for an injunction pending appeal (Docket Entry No. [ # 11 ]) is denied. See Winter v. Nat. Res. Def. Council, Inc., 555 U.S. 7, 20 (2008). Appellants request to extend the grant of interim relief, set forth in the reply brief in support of the motion, is denied. The interim stay granted in the March 11, 2022 order is terminated. The existing briefing schedule remains in effect. BADE, Circuit Judge, dissenting: I would grant the emergency motion for an injunction pending appeal and, in the absence of an injunction, I would extend interim relief to allow Appellant to seek emergency relief from the Supreme Court.
